Evidence
- IBS is related to mast cells.
- IBS increases colorectal adenoma and carcinoma.
- Many mast cells are in the colorectal adenoma.
- Suppressing the activity of mast cells decreases colorectal adenoma.
- There is no significant relationship between allergy and colon.
- Low-FODMAP diet improves IBS symptoms.
- Low FODMAP reduces mast cells.
- In Japan, colorectal cancer is increasing with the increase of High-FODMAP foods.
Theoretical
hypothesis
Low-FODMAP diet might prevent colorectal adenoma and carcinoma.
